Mapping the music sector in Bulgaria
18 November 2024

The Project “Mapping the Music Sector in Bulgaria” is a two-year initiative of the BMA, aimed at collecting and analyzing qualitative and quantitative information about the state of the Bulgarian music sector. Its goal is to support the development of effective cultural policies and financing instruments to meet the needs of the sector, especially after the consequences of the pandemic and the socio-economic crisis.

In recent years the BMA has worked closely with state and local institutions to develop strategic documents and to create mechanisms to support the music sector.

The mobile application “Musical Guide to Stage Spaces in Bulgaria” was created within the framework of the project and contains information about the identified music spaces with their characteristics and terms of use. It will be available for free download in Google Play and Apple Store at the beggining of 2025.

Mobile application

The “Musical Guide to Stage Spaces in Bulgaria” is the result of the two-year project for wide-ranging mapping of the music sector in the country, which the BMA launched in 2020 as part of its sectoral initiatives. The aim of the project is to improve information provision and support the development of effective cultural policies and financing mechanisms.

The application is open to all stage spaces in Bulgaria, offering easy and quick access to an extensive array of data. This enables artists-performers to plan their activities without wasting time on additional research, making the process more efficient and easy.

We believe that this product will be of great benefit not only to the music sector, but also to all other performing arts, helping to facilitate their integration and development in the cultural scene of Bulgaria.

The app will be free for download at the end of January 2025.
